150 years ago a quilt block rose to popularity and soon became an American quilting icon. This block, of course, is the beloved Log Cabin.
Times have changed since those first blocks were stitched on the frontier but what hasn't changed is the comfort of a handmade quilt that provides the recipient with the warmth of hearth and home.
